3,3'-{1,1'-Methyl-enebis[naphthalene-2,1-diylbis(oxymethyl-ene)]}dibenzonitrile
1Ordered Matter Science Research Center, College of Chemistry and Chemical Engineering, Southeast University, Nanjing 210096, People's Republic of China.
Abstract:
The title compound, C(37)H(26)N(2)O(2), was synthesized from 1,1'-methyl-enedinaphthalen-2-ol and 3-(bromo-methyl)-benzo-nitrile. The two naphthyl systems are almost perpendicular to each other [dihedral angle 83.3 (9)°] and the two cyano-benz-yloxy rings approximately parallel to each other [dihedral angle 15.5 (2)°].

Nomenclature of Aromatic Compounds with Multiple Substituents
For disubstituted benzene derivatives, with two groups attached to the benzene ring, three constitutional isomers are possible. For example, consider dimethyl benzene, often called xylene, where the second methyl group can be substituted at the second, third, or fourth carbon.
